Gauteng roads have registered a tragic start to the weekend. 

A man in his mid-20s has died and four others suffered moderate to critical injuries in a head-on collision between two light motor vehicles on Main Reef Road, Rynsoord, Benoni on Friday evening.

According to ER24's Ross Campbell, paramedics arrived at 21:17 to find that two occupants from one car had been ejected and three from another vehicle had self extricated. 

"Of the two ejected, one showed no signs of life and was declared dead on the scene. The other, a man in his mid-30s had suffered critical injuries, was treated with Advanced Life Support interventions by another service and taken to a private hospital in the area,"
 said Campbell.

The three men from the second vehicle were all thought to be between the ages of 30 and 40 and had suffered moderate injuries. They were treated on scene and taken to Far East Rand Provincial Hospital for further care.

In addition, two adult males, believed to be the father and grandfather of two teenagers injured in the same vehicle collision on the corner of Wierda Road and the R55, Sunderland Ridge, North of Centurion on Friday afternoon, have died. 

"It is suspected that a truck may have rear-ended the two light motor vehicles on the scene," said Campbell. 

"A 15-year-old female was found to have suffered serious injuries, was treated with Advanced Life Support interventions before being transported to a private hospital for further care. A 13-year-old male was found to have suffered critical injuries and was airlifted to a private hospital."
